Default Kuala Lumpur

Got parents coming to visit us in Melbourne (been here since August but flew with Singapore) and they are coming with Malaysian Airlines. The connecting flight from KL to Mel means a 6 hours wait for them at KL airport! Is that a long time to spend at that particular airport or is there enough there for them to see and do to kill those 6 long hours? Your opinions on this one would be appreciated... Are there any sight-seeing trips from the airport that anyone knows of, or would they have to stay in the airport??

I've been through it 4 times and whilst it's a beautifull airport I wouldn't say there's that much to do. There are quite a few shops selling trinkets etc but I don't think enough to fill 6 hours. Unfortunately the city centre of KL is about an hour or more from the airport by taxi. I think there's a shuttle train but I'm not sure how long it takes.

We had a long wait in KL a couple of years ago and had 2 year old twins in tow! So we booked a room in the hotel at the airport. Reclaimed baggage, walked through airport to hotel, showered, slept, went for a swim - the hotel had shuttles into KL city but it is about an hour away so we didn't bother. Not certain but I think the airport has a rail link to the city.
Would highly recommend getting a room at the hotel.

KL airport is simply one of the best airports I have ever been to. It's immaculate and not busy one bit. There isn't a huge amount to do, so you can always suggest a stopover?

We stopped in KL and took a short flight to Penang. We stayed there for a couple of nights to break up the journey and help with time difference etc. Most airlines will offer a stopover included in the price (flight transfer). If they've already booked, it's well worth enquiring with them.
